Dat ga ik dan ook nog eens proberenquote:Op dinsdag 12 augustus 2008 13:36 schreef HenkBenzinetank het volgende:
Wat sIFR betreft, het kan ook aan je lettertype liggen. Met name sommige OTF letters trekt ie niet zo goed
1 2 3 | een regel past dd-mm-jjjj > korte tekst op 1 regel |
Zorgen dat je datum altijd in hetzelfde formaat is (dus altijd dd-mm-yyyy en niet één keer d-mm-yy en de andere keer dd-m-yyyy) en deze een vaste breedte laten hanteren (monospace lettertype gebruiken?), vervolgens het plaatje als background-image, en de te 'wrappen' tekst in een span.quote:Op maandag 18 augustus 2008 22:53 schreef Light het volgende:
Een probleempje waar ik laatst mee zat en wat ik niet opgelost kreeg met css. Misschien heeft iemand hier nog een idee hoe het met css netjes moet kunnen?
Eerst het probleem:
[ code verwijderd ]
Waar het > staat moet een plaatje komen. Dat kan normaal heel goed met een list-style-image, maar dan zit ik in de knoop met de datum die daarvoor staat. Bij een andere variant waar die datum er niet is, wordt alles uiteraard als list weergegeven. En semantisch gezien is dit ook een lijst, dus wilde ik het ook zo weergeven. Maar door de vreemde plaatsing van de datum is me dat niet gelukt.
Heeft iemand een idee hoe ik dit had kunnen oplossen met een list, en wel zo dat als de titel na de > te lang wordt, deze gaat inspringen zodat alles netjes onder elkaar blijft staan?
1 2 3 4 5 6 7 8 | height: 20px /* hoogte van de knoppen */' width: 700px; /* breedte van het menu, nodig om te centreren */ margin: 0 auto; /* zet linker en rechter marges op automatisch, dus het menu in het midden */ top: 75px; z-index: 100px; line-height: /* finishing touch, centreer tekst verticaal */ } |
Om iets te centreren moet je het een breedte geven (en dan een kleinere breedte dan het element waar het in staat). Als je body 1000px breed is en je menu ook dan valt er niet veel te centrerenquote:Op maandag 25 augustus 2008 14:00 schreef LeeHarveyOswald het volgende:
hmm ik ben weer eens met mn menu-vanuit-een-database aan het stoeien, maar ik kom dr niet uit (klote css).
Het menu heb ik qua opzet hiervandaan geplukt: http://tutorials.alsacreations.com/deroulant/
(grootste verschil is dat ik de opbouw als moeder/dochter structuur in een database heb staan en met 2 loopjes dit er uit pluk - dat werkt).
Enige wat mij niet lukt is het centreren ... op http://pestforum.nl/users/test.php draai ik een testje, op http://pestforum.nl/users/white.css staat't CSS - de boosdoener. left = 50% zet het linkerpunt van het menu mooi gecentreerd - maar ik wil dus het hele menu centreren.
Mocht iemand weten hoe - dan hoor ik het heel graag- Ik kan wel handmatig centreren, maar dat is niet echt een oplossing bij een dynamisch menu
Eens. Ik vind de Son of Suckerfish-implementatie altijd wel handig. En lekker overzichtelijk kleinquote:Op maandag 25 augustus 2008 17:18 schreef HenkBenzinetank het volgende:
Komt ie dan he:
[ code verwijderd ]
persoonlijk vind ik het een beetje een zuur menu. Als je muis eraf hovert, blijft ie open staan.
min-width zou dan kunnen werkenquote:Op maandag 25 augustus 2008 19:57 schreef Light het volgende:
[..]
Om iets te centreren moet je het een breedte geven (en dan een kleinere breedte dan het element waar het in staat). Als je body 1000px breed is en je menu ook dan valt er niet veel te centrerenEn als je body 1000px breed is en je menu 500px dan kun je wel centreren. Probleem met een dynamisch menu is dat je niet weet hoeveel items er in zitten, dus hoe breed het menu moet worden. Dat kun je wel weer oplossen met een stukje javascript. Een idee is dan om in je template ( / html) een variabele te setten die aangeeft hoeveel menu-items er zijn. De rest regel je dan met een stukje javascript in een ander bestand.
Maar niet erg IE6 compatible helaas.quote:Op maandag 25 augustus 2008 20:06 schreef HenkBenzinetank het volgende:
min-width zou dan kunnen werken![]()
1 2 3 4 5 6 7 8 9 | body { width: 100%; height: 100%; min-width:800px; /* This takes care of all the 'decent' browsers */ margin: 0px; padding: 0px; /*optional*/ /* Optionally set text-align: center; and increase the padding if you wish to have the page centered with margins... */ } |
1 2 | width:expression(document.body.clientWidth < 600? "600px" : document.body.clientWidth > 1200? "1200px" : "auto"); |
quote:Op maandag 25 augustus 2008 17:18 schreef HenkBenzinetank het volgende:
Komt ie dan he:
[ code verwijderd ]
persoonlijk vind ik het een beetje een zuur menu. Als je muis eraf hovert, blijft ie open staan.
1 2 3 4 5 6 7 8 | position: absolute; width: 700px; /* breedte van het menu, nodig om te centreren */ margin: 0 auto; /* zet linker en rechter marges op automatisch, dus het menu in het midden */ top: 75px; z-index: 100px; line-height: /* finishing touch, centreer tekst verticaal */ } |
Dus dit is meer wat ik nodig heb?quote:Op maandag 25 augustus 2008 20:33 schreef HenkBenzinetank het volgende:
[ code verwijderd ]
of
[ code verwijderd ]
u vraagt, google draait
IE6 moet dan ook dood.quote:Op maandag 25 augustus 2008 20:09 schreef CraZaay het volgende:
[..]
Maar niet erg IE6 compatible helaas.
Gewoon Windows Update gebruiken. Is dat ding toch ergens goed voorquote:Op maandag 25 augustus 2008 22:12 schreef CraZaay het volgende:
[..]
Eensch. Maar maak dat die 30+% van alle internetgebruikers ook maar wijs
Sinds wanneer haalt die Firefox binnen?quote:Op maandag 25 augustus 2008 22:18 schreef Light het volgende:
[..]
Gewoon Windows Update gebruiken. Is dat ding toch ergens goed voor
Hmm.... goed punt.. Maar 'k maak liever iets voor IE7 dan voor IE6. IE7 werkt al 100x beter.quote:Op maandag 25 augustus 2008 22:39 schreef LeeHarveyOswald het volgende:
[..]
Sinds wanneer haalt die Firefox binnen?
Yip. En je kan nog zo vurig willen dat mensen upgraden naar IE7, feit blijft dat 3 op alle 10 bezoekers IE6 gebruiken. Da's best veelquote:Op maandag 25 augustus 2008 22:56 schreef HenkBenzinetank het volgende:
Punt is alleen dat uitgerekend je klanten op hun kantoortjes vaak allemaal een verrotte windows xp installatie met IE6 hebben..
Zo'n 29% van de IE gebruikers van 2 van mijn sites (boeroendoek.nl en pestforum.nl) gebruiken op dit moment nog IE6. Dat is dus minder dan 1/3e van de IE gebruikers. 70% van de bezoekers is een IE bezoeker, dus pakweg 1/5e van de bezoekers is IE6 (en dat op ca. 5000 bezoekers/maand, redelijk representatief dus).quote:Op maandag 25 augustus 2008 23:02 schreef CraZaay het volgende:
[..]
Yip. En je kan nog zo vurig willen dat mensen upgraden naar IE7, feit blijft dat 3 op alle 10 bezoekers IE6 gebruiken. Da's best veel
Verschilt bij mij ook heel veel. Als ik de Boekenbox (uit m'n sig) of mijn blog neem dan zit ik gemiddeld op 57% Mozilla (waarvan 40% Firefox ouder dan versie 3.x), 15% IE7, 21% IE6 en de rest Safari/Opera/etc.quote:Op maandag 25 augustus 2008 23:32 schreef CraZaay het volgende:
Het ligt ook aan de doelgroep natuurlijk; de grotere publiekssites die ik ontwikkel hebben al gauw 90+% (!!) IE bezoekers. Nadeel van sites voor het grote publiek is dat ze vaak op scholen en kantoren gebruikt worden (en tussen 9.00 en 17.00 komt daar het merendeel van het bezoek vandaan), en daar hebben ze weer relatief veel IE6.
We zullen ermee moeten leven
Lucky youquote:Op dinsdag 26 augustus 2008 11:36 schreef HenkBenzinetank het volgende:
Op mijn site (veel bezocht door creatieven) is het aandeel IE6 marginaal, Safari en Opera scoren (net als FF natuurlijk) veel hoger. Er is daarom vrijwel geen tijd gestoken in het IE6 compatibel maken![]()
Zelfde gaat op voor pestforum.nl. Meeste hits komen van kennisnet, onder schooltijd. Ook daar valt het kwartje dus.quote:Op maandag 25 augustus 2008 23:32 schreef CraZaay het volgende:
Het ligt ook aan de doelgroep natuurlijk; de grotere publiekssites die ik ontwikkel hebben al gauw 90+% (!!) IE bezoekers. Nadeel van sites voor het grote publiek is dat ze vaak op scholen en kantoren gebruikt worden (en tussen 9.00 en 17.00 komt daar het merendeel van het bezoek vandaan), en daar hebben ze weer relatief veel IE6.
We zullen ermee moeten leven
Ik zie de variatie in besturingssystemen ook langzaam aan toenemenquote:Op dinsdag 26 augustus 2008 08:41 schreef Tuvai.net het volgende:
[..]
Verschilt bij mij ook heel veel. Als ik de Boekenbox (uit m'n sig) of mijn blog neem dan zit ik gemiddeld op 57% Mozilla (waarvan 40% Firefox ouder dan versie 3.x), 15% IE7, 21% IE6 en de rest Safari/Opera/etc.
Bij de gemiddelde applicatie van m'n werk zit ik makkelijk boven de 80% aan IE gebruikers, waarvan het grootste percentage jammer genoeg nog steeds op IE6. Wel merk ik dat steeds meer mensen, zowel bij mijn thuisprojectjes als bij mijn grotere projecten op het werk, steeds meer interesse hebben in andere browsers en veel klanten ook al aangeven dat hun website/applicatie 'wel op alle browsers moet werken'.Goede ontwikkeling vind ik zelf, dan vallen al die prutsers die nog steeds enkel voor browser X devven al buiten de boot.
Euh?quote:Op donderdag 28 augustus 2008 14:43 schreef ruud_fr het volgende:
ik bedoel dus eigenlijk dat de achtergrond in het tekstvak blijft staan als het vak groter (scrollbaar) wordt d.m.v. typen
quote:Op donderdag 28 augustus 2008 11:57 schreef ruud_fr het volgende:
is er een mogelijkheid om een background in een textarea fixed te maken? het lukt mij niet...
1 2 3 | background-position: bottom left; } |
Lijkt mij nogal een show stopperquote:Op vrijdag 29 augustus 2008 08:17 schreef Light het volgende:
Het nadeel is dat als iemand met de cursortoetsen weer omhoog gaat scrollen, de achtergrond naar beneden gaat.
prima oplossing dusquote:Op vrijdag 29 augustus 2008 08:07 schreef CraZaay het volgende:
Met "position" scrollt de afbeelding nog steeds mee uiteraard. Het kan niet door simpelweg de textarea te stylen; "background-attachment: fixed" werkt niet in IE6. Als je het ook in IE6 wilt laten werken kom je uit bij een element met de gewenste achtergrondafbeelding en daarbinnen de textarea met "background: transparent".
The holy grailquote:Op donderdag 4 september 2008 13:52 schreef Chandler het volgende:
Wat wil ik met het middelste gedeelte!?
Links & Rechts zijn vast qua maat
MID is variabel en moet meerekken met de breedte van het scherm.
Echter moet de content (mid) kunnen doorlopen... en dat lukt mij niet.
Lutserquote:Op donderdag 4 september 2008 14:45 schreef Chandler het volgende:
want anders ben ik bang dat ik weer voor tabellen moet gaan kiezen...
Forum Opties | |
---|---|
Forumhop: | |
Hop naar: |